Understanding Liability in Palmdale Freeway Collisions

Establishing liability is the cornerstone of any successful highway accident claim. In California, personal injury law operates under the principle of negligence, meaning that the at fault party breached a duty of care owed to you, directly causing your injuries and damages. On Palmdale’s major thoroughfares, common causes of negligence leading to a high speed collision include distracted driving, such as texting or using a phone; speeding, which reduces reaction time; driving under the influence of drugs or alcohol; and driver fatigue.

Proving fault in a significant road traffic incident requires meticulous investigation and evidence collection. This can involve gathering police reports, witness statements, traffic camera footage, cell phone records, accident reconstruction analyses, and expert testimony. Types of Damages You Can Recover After a Major Roadway Accident

Victims of a highway accident in Palmdale are often entitled to recover a wide range of damages designed to compensate them for their losses. These damages are typically categorized as economic and non economic. Economic damages are quantifiable monetary losses and can include past and future medical expenses, such as emergency care, surgeries, rehabilitation, and medication; lost wages and loss of earning capacity; and property damage to your vehicle or other belongings.

Non economic damages, while harder to quantify, are equally crucial for your recovery. They compensate for subjective losses like pain and suffering, emotional distress, mental anguish, loss of enjoyment of life, and disfigurement. The Litigation Process for a Highway Accident Claim in Palmdale

While many personal injury claims stemming from a Palmdale high speed collision settle out of court, it is important to be prepared for the possibility of litigation. The legal process typically begins with a thorough investigation and demand letter sent to the at fault party’s insurance company. If negotiations do not yield a satisfactory offer, our attorneys may file a lawsuit. This initiates the discovery phase, where both sides exchange information, including depositions, interrogatories, and requests for documents.

Following discovery, many cases proceed to mediation, an alternative dispute resolution method where a neutral third party helps both sides reach a settlement. If a resolution cannot be reached through these avenues, the case may proceed to trial. Frequently Asked Questions

What should I do immediately after a highway accident in Palmdale?

Prioritize safety by moving to a safe location if possible. Check for injuries, call 911 to report the incident and ensure a police report is made, and exchange information with other drivers. Seek medical attention immediately, even if injuries seem minor, and document the scene with photos or videos. Do not admit fault or give recorded statements to insurance adjusters without legal counsel.

How long do I have to file a personal injury lawsuit for a freeway collision in California?

In California, the general statute of limitations for most personal injury claims is two years from the date of the accident. However, there are exceptions, particularly if a government entity is involved, which may have much shorter deadlines. It is crucial to consult with an attorney as soon as possible to ensure you do not miss critical filing deadlines.

What if I was partially at fault for the highway accident?

California follows a ‘pure comparative negligence’ rule. This means you can still recover damages even if you were partially at fault for the highway incident. However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. An attorney can help argue for a lower percentage of fault attributed to you and maximize your recovery.

Can I recover damages if the at fault driver has no insurance?

If the at fault driver is uninsured or underinsured, you may be able to file a claim under your own uninsured or underinsured motorist (UM/UIM) coverage. This coverage is designed to protect you in such situations. Review your policy with a legal professional to understand your options.

How long does a typical highway accident personal injury claim take?

The duration of a personal injury claim can vary significantly based on factors like the severity of injuries, complexity of liability, cooperation of insurance companies, and court backlogs. Simple cases might resolve in a few months, while complex ones requiring litigation could take several years. An attorney can provide a more accurate timeline for your specific circumstances.

What are common injuries from a Palmdale highway accident?

Common injuries from high speed collisions on major roadways include whiplash, fractures, traumatic brain injuries (TBIs), spinal cord injuries, internal organ damage, severe lacerations, and psychological trauma such as PTSD. The impact of such incidents often leads to long term medical care and rehabilitation.
